description
  • <p> This family represents eukaryotic protein disulphide isomerases retained in the endoplasmic reticulum (ER) and other closely related forms. Some members have been assigned alternative or additional functions such as prolyl 4-hydroxylase anddolichyl-diphosphooligosaccharide-protein glycotransferase. Members of this family have at least two protein-disulphide domains, each similar to thioredoxin but with the redox-active disulphide in the motif PWCGHCK, and an ER retention signal at the extreme C terminus (KDEL, HDEL, and similar motifs).</p>
